#db995e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#db995e is composed of 85.9% red, 60%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.1% magenta, 57.1%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 28.3 degrees, a saturation of 63.5% and a lightness of 61.4%. #db995e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ffbc with #b73300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#db995e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0903 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#db995e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e9c9b is the less saturated color, while #f99740 is the most saturated one.
